Homemade Creole Seasoning
"Many store-bought Creole seasonings are mostly salt, sometimes with added chemical preservatives and anti-caking agents. This simple seasoning blend is a mixture of salt, pepper, dried herbs and spices. How's this for anti-caking: Shake the Jar! Adapted from Chef Virginia Willis' cookbook "Bon Appetit Y'all", and is very, very good."
